Delaware Speedway Front Runner Announces Winter Plans

    Andrew Gresel ( Sauble Beach, On)  and Sauble Falls Racing are heading south to New Smyrna Speedway this February 11th -19th. The recent success of 3rd overall in the NASCAR Whelen All American Series in Ontario along with at Delaware Speedway in the 2010 season has inspired the entire SFR team to look south during the winter months to compete in the "World Series of Asphalt Racing"  www.newsmyrnaspeedway.org . This week long affair will test the race team's skills and will help build the overall preparations needed to shoot for a championship at the famous Delaware Speedway. Canada has always had a large presence at Speedweeks dating back to the legendary years with Jr Hanley and Bill Zardo Sr and in recent years the high banks of New Smyrna Beach, Florida has seen the likes of Kirk Hooker and Brandon Watson and a host of other top competitors.

    Sauble Falls Racing will be competing in the "ASA Crate Late" Division against teams from all over North America. This off season will allow the team to regroup and prepare for the 8 straight days of racing in February.
